I don't really mind which brand of hand wash I buy but I do buy lots of branded ones while they are reduced in price on offer. I bought this one for a £1. I usually do not pay much more than a £1 because more often than not I always find one for around that price to buy. This liquid comes housed in a plastic bottle, it has a pump dispenser, the wash is white and it is a rich textured wash. It is also a smooth texture. It contains camomile which is an ingredient to help to smooth the skin and help it to be moisturised. It also contains an ingredient of jojoba oil.
